My father and his family saw a lot of films with René Dary, "120 Rue de la gare" being their favorite. He excelled in sailors, and in here, he's again dynamic and charming, well surrounded by truculent Julien Carette and Aimos (as the mute). There are some funny boozing scenes, of course with sailors what else, and a light sentimental suspense. And a threatening bartender and his "blend of the boss" (mélange du patron). Very entertaining comedy and direction by Albert Valentin is competent, but his 2 best movies are the 2 following, "Marie Martine" and the vitriolic "la Vie de plaisir".
